The Government is committed to consideration of how best to recognise humanitarian service in a range of ways, including existing honours and medals and as part of wider
developments in medallic recognition. Examples include the announcement in 2015 of the Ebola Medal, which recognised people from both military and civilian organisations for
their brave service to assist communities in West Africa. This new medal was announced alongside existing honours in the Orders of St. Michael and St. George and the Order of
the British Empire for people whose contribution to tackling the crisis was part of well-established outstanding service.<\/p>

Recommendations for new medals are made to HM The Queen by the Committee on the Grant of Honours, Decorations and Medals.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4451",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Kevin Foster"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Torbay"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Kevin Foster"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-07-02",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-07-02T17:59:53.9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"53"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"Cabinet Office"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"Cabinet Office"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-27",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Humanitarian Aid: Medals"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, if he will make an assessment of the potential merits of striking a medal for humanitarian service; and if he will make a statement.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/1490",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Mrs Madeleine Moon"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Bridgend"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Mrs Madeleine Moon"} ], "uin" : "270317"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1135297",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Department of Health and Social Care"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1135297/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"

European Commission Directive 2006/125/EC on processed cereal-based foods and baby foods sets maximum limits on the sugar content of processed cereal-based foods for infants and young children.<\/p>

<\/p>

It is the responsibility of food businesses to ensure they comply with the relevant legislation. Enforcement of food law is the responsibility of local authorities.<\/p>

<\/p>

Public Health England\u2019s (PHE) review \u2018Foods and drinks aimed at infants and young children: evidence and opportunities for action\u2019 was published in June 2019. The Department is considering PHE\u2019s advice and the opportunities for action to improve the nutritional quality of foods aimed at infants and young children.<\/p>

The purpose of the automated checks is to help the applicant establish their continuous residence in the UK. Eligibility to receive benefits is not dependent upon being continuously resident in the UK. Benefits except Job Seekers Allowance and Maternity Allowance on their own are not strong indicators of continuous residence unless receipt of them persists over a period of 12 months. There are also overlaps with other data that is available from the checks. For instance, PAYE data covers most applicants who claim working tax credits and receipt of other benefits included in the checks will overlap with receipt of child tax credits. Child Benefit is not included in the automated checks because it is not a sufficient indicator of continuous UK residence. A full explanation of how the automated checks work has been published at https://www.gov.uk/guidance/eu-settlement-scheme-uk-tax-and-benefits-records-automated-check.<\/a><\/p>

Following analysis conducted on an anonymised sample of 10,000 applications submitted under the Immigration (European Economic Area) Regulations 2006, the Home Office estimated that the potential pool of resident EEA citizens who might benefit from tax credits data being included in the automated checks was around two per cent and this was before any consideration of the applicability of that data to proving continuous residence. Individuals who need to rely on tax credits to demonstrate their continuous residence are still able to provide documentary evidence of this as part of their application.<\/p>

In accordance with section 149 of the Equality Act 2010, we have had due regard to the Public Sector Equality Duty.<\/p>

General practice is where most patients with chronic fatigue syndrome/myalgic encephalomyelitis are likely to be managed, and the condition is identified as a key area of clinical knowledge in the Royal College of General Practitioners (GPs) Applied Knowledge Test (AKT) content guide. The AKT is a summative assessment of the knowledge base that underpins general practice in the United Kingdom within the context of the National Health Service and is a key part of GPs\u2019 qualifying exams.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4455",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Seema Kennedy"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"South Ribble"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Seema Kennedy"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-07-02",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-07-02T16:33:49.427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"17"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"Health and Social Care"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"Health and Social Care"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-27",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Chronic Fatigue Syndrome"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, pursuant to the oral contribution on 21 June 2018 Vol 643 c229WH, what steps his Department has taken to improve GP awareness of ME.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/1397",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Hywel Williams"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Arfon"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Hywel Williams"} ], "uin" : "270308"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1134982",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Ministry of Justice"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1134982/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"

The Ministry of Justice has published information regarding prosecutions and convictions but the only hate crime offences specifically defined in legislation are \u2018racially or religiously aggravated\u2019 offences. The court outcomes for these offences can be found here:<\/p>

https://assets.publishing.service.gov.uk/government/uploads/system/uploads/attachment_data/file/802314/outcomes-by-offence-tool-2018.xlsx<\/a><\/p>

Filter by \u2018Offence\u2019 for offences starting with \u2018racially or religiously aggravated\u2026\u2019 and select all that appear.<\/p>

<\/p>

As hate crime against individuals with learning disabilities is not specifically defined in legislation, we would not be able to distinguish whether or not a particular offence was related to a learning disability. For example, a relevant case could have the offence recorded simply as \u2018common assault\u2019. The level of detail required to answer this question may be held in court records, but to be able to identify these cases we would have to access and analyse individual court records which would be of disproportionate cost.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/3926",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Paul Maynard"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Blackpool North and Cleveleys"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Paul Maynard"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-07-02",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-07-02T16:45:45.177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"54"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"Justice"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"Justice"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-26",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Hate Crime: Disability"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for Justice, how many (a) prosecutions and (b) convictions there were for hate crimes against people with learning disabilities in (i) 2018 and (ii) 2017.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/422",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Mr Chris Leslie"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Nottingham East"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Mr Chris Leslie"} ], "uin" : "269643"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1135027",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Department for Education"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1135027/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"

An estimate of the number of people with a long-term mental health condition who leave employment each year, regardless of whether they became unemployed, is available from the 2017 report Thriving at Work: a review of mental health and employers<\/em>, an independent review of mental health and employers by Lord Dennis Stevenson and Paul Farmer. This report estimated that there were around 300,000 such moves in the year 2016-17 in the UK<\/p>

<\/p>

Notes:<\/p>

  1. This estimate was based on quarterly estimates from the two-wave longitudinal Labour Force Survey (LFS) between Q2 2016 and Q2 2017.<\/li>
  2. Each individual in the data is measured at two snapshot interviews, one quarter apart. The estimate identifies people who were in employment in the first interview, but not in employment in the second interview. The data does not capture any movements before or after this quarterly period, or any short-term moves that may have been reversed between the two snapshot interviews. It should however give a broad measure of the degree of \u2018churn\u2019.<\/li>
  3. The estimate does not capture the reason each individual left employment, which may or may not have been related to their health condition.<\/li>
  4. The annual estimate may double-count an individual if they have left employment twice in the same year.<\/li>
  5. As this analysis is based on longitudinal survey data, the precision and accuracy of the estimate can be affected by response errors, sampling errors and attrition bias.<\/li>
  6. The estimate covers people who reported the same health condition in both quarters, and remained in the 16-64 age group.<\/li>
  7. Employment is defined according to National Statistics definitions, as used in the ONS\u2019s monthly Labour Market Overview<\/em> release, in line with internationally-agreed (ILO) guidelines.<\/li>
  8. A long-term health condition is defined as a physical or mental health condition or illness lasting or expected to last 12 months or more, in line with Government Statistical Service (GSS) Harmonised Principles. This includes those who are disabled (who report that their condition or illness reduces their ability to carry out day-to-day activities) and those who are not disabled.<\/li>
  9. Mental health conditions are defined as any condition reported by survey respondents under the categories \u201cdepression, bad nerves or anxiety\u201d or \u201cmental illness, phobias, panics or other nervous disorders\u201d. People who report a long-term health condition but do not specify the type are excluded from this analysis.<\/li><\/ol>

    There are currently no full time equivalent vacancies for Civilian Enforcement Officers (CEOs) within Her Majesty\u2019s Courts and Tribunal Service (HMCTS). CEOs primarily execute financial penalty arrest warrants and community penalty breach warrants and existing contracts with Approved Enforcement Agencies also provide for the execution of these warrants. This dual approach means there is no requirement for a fixed number of CEOs to ensure this work is undertaken. The number of Civilian Enforcement Officers has reduced over recent years, which reflects a reduction in the number of warrants issued.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/3926",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Paul Maynard"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Blackpool North and Cleveleys"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Paul Maynard"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2019-07-02",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2019-07-02T16:35:16.817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"54"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"Justice"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"Justice"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2019-06-25",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Debt Collection"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for Justice, how many full time equivalent vacancies for Civilian Enforcement Officers there are.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4521",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Liz Saville Roberts"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Dwyfor Meirionnydd"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Liz Saville Roberts"} ], "uin" : "269145"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1134615",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Ministry of Justice"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1134615/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"
